Card 02: Drill 2/12. Pause at the top of swing.

Pause at the top of BS for a fraction of a second. This lets you gather all body parts going into DS.

Start DS with a gravity drop using hips and shoulders to begin rotation into DS transition. This permits time to get shaft on the plane line it had at address.

Card 05: Be in Sync!

Sync arm swing with body turn, this is main cause for slice: shoulder and upper body unwind too fast in DS, throwing hands and arms outside the swing plane.

Body position: Think of your hands and arms swinging down to hip height (transition level club) BEFORE your body starts to unwind.
